What are Esterquats?

Esterquats are a type of quaternary ammonium compound that feature ester linkages in their molecular structure. This design imparts several desirable properties that set them apart from older generations of fabric softening agents. Dipalmitoylethyl Hydroxyethylmonium Methosulfate (CAS No. 161294-46-8) is a prominent example, synthesized from fatty acids and alcohols.

Key Performance Advantages of Esterquats

When formulators decide to buy esterquats, they are often looking for superior performance characteristics that enhance the end product:

  • Enhanced Softness and Smoothness: Esterquats are renowned for their ability to deliver exceptional fabric softness. The structure allows for efficient adsorption onto fabric fibers, providing a luxurious feel. This makes them a primary choice when seeking to buy ingredients that impart premium tactile qualities.
  • Improved Biodegradability: A significant advantage of esterquats, particularly those derived from vegetable sources like palm oil, is their superior biodegradability compared to traditional quaternary ammonium compounds. This aligns with the growing consumer preference for eco-friendly products. Manufacturers often highlight this feature when marketing their Dipalmitoylethyl Hydroxyethylmonium Methosulfate.
  • Antistatic Properties: Like other cationic surfactants, esterquats effectively reduce static electricity on fabrics, improving wearer comfort and ease of handling during laundering.
  • Good Rewettability: Esterquats generally offer better rewetting characteristics, meaning fabrics treated with them retain a good level of absorbency, which is important for items like towels.
  • Formulation Flexibility: They are compatible with a wide range of formulation types, including highly concentrated liquids, allowing for innovative product designs and reduced packaging.
